  • Fretwork: This layered art form involves cutting designs into a surface, often wood, creating delicate patterns and textures. Fretwork is used in various applications, from furniture and musical instruments to decorative panels and architectural details. The level of skill and precision required to create complex fretwork is remarkable. Its appearance varies widely depending on the artist's style and the materials used.

  • Fibulae: These ancient Roman brooches serve as compelling examples of craftsmanship and artistic expression. Fibulae were used to fasten garments and often featured nuanced designs and precious materials. Their discovery provides archaeologists with valuable information about Roman society, fashion, and artistic techniques. Studying their variations helps historians understand different periods and social classes within the Roman Empire.

  • Fractals: These complex geometrical shapes appear in various natural phenomena and are characterized by self-similarity at different scales. The study of fractals involves advanced mathematics and has implications for various scientific fields. Their beauty and complexity have also made them a source of artistic inspiration.
